First a little background on Hoff. (And since he has done just about everything but run for president, I can’t possibly do the man’s career justice with this tiny article).
He starred on the daytime soap,” The Young and The Restless,” and even had some top ten songs. One did particularly well in Germany in 1989 and it was called “Looking for Freedom”, which coincided with the fall of the Berlin Wall.
The Hollywood Walk of Fame bares his star and in 2006, he was a celebrity judge on “America’s Got Talent.” Hasselhoff also wrote a book called Making Waves, which was released in the UK and has starred in a myriad of films, TV shows, plays and the list goes on and on. In fact, check out his IMDB listing for all the details on his career. Essentially, it is safe to say that Hoff has done just about everything and he has millions of devoted fans to show for it.
Also on the credit side for “The Hoff” are his two beautiful daughters, Taylor-Ann, 19 as of today (happy b-day Taylor) and 16-year old Hayley. In 2006, he filed for divorce due to “irreconcilable differences” and now he shares joint custody of his kids with his ex-wife, Pamela Bach. Daily News’ Issie Lapowsky writes:
David Hasselhoff’s hospitalization after a night of drinking has descended into an (alleged) he said-she said battle.
Early reports stated that the former “Baywatch” hunk, who has suffered from alcohol abuse, was found unconscious on Saturday night with a .39 blood alcohol level. The Hoff was foaming at the mouth – a sign of alcohol poisoning – when his daughter Hayley discovered him and rushed him to the hospital, according to RadarOnline.com.
But the actor’s lawyers tells TMZ the story has been exaggerated, blaming Hasselhoff’s ex-wife Pamela Bach for the drama which, he says, is “in violation of the court’s order precluding contacting the media regarding her ex husband.”
Hasselhoff’s rep says the star had been drinking when he got in an argument with Hayley. He had also been feeling ill, his flack says, and reportedly walked himself to his car and was driven to the hospital.
Hasselhoff was released from the hospital on Monday, and, according to his spokeswoman, is “fine and well and happy.” His lawyers later released a statement to “Extra,” saying the actor was “disturbed and saddened by the fact that a certain individual is disseminating grossly inaccurate stories about him to the press for ulterior motives.”
Hasselhoff raised eyebrows in 2007 when a video of the actor drunkenly eating a cheeseburger leaked online. The video was shot by his daughter, who begged him off-camera to stop drinking.
Hasselhoff’s lawyer has reportedly vowed to take Bach to court over the story.
